News Corp (NASDAQ: NWSA) is a diversified media and information services firm that creates and distributes content across five segments-Digital Real Estate Services, Dow Jones, Book Publishing, News Media, and Other. Its portfolio spans flagship brands such as The Wall Street Journal, Barron’s, MarketWatch, and the New York Post, as well as a suite of newspapers in Australia, the United Kingdom, and the United States, plus digital mastheads, podcasts, and a social-media content agency (Storyful). The company monetizes through subscriptions, advertising, data products, and real-estate services, operating globally from the U.S. and Europe to Australasia.

- Dividend Yield
- Annual dividend per share divided by current share price.
- Payout Ratio
- Percentage of earnings paid as dividends. Below 60% = safe, above 100% = unsustainable.
- Payout FCF
- Percentage of Free Cash Flow paid as dividends. More reliable than Payout Ratio since it measures actual cash.
- Growth Rate (CAGR)
- Compound annual growth rate of dividends over the last 5 years.
- Consistency
- Reliability of dividend payments over lifetime. Penalizes cuts and pauses.
- Yield on Cost
- Your effective yield if you bought 5 years ago. Shows dividend growth impact over time.
- Streak
- Consecutive years of dividend payments. 25+ years = Dividend Aristocrat.
- Dividend Rating
- Proprietary score (0-100) combining yield, growth, safety and consistency.
